随着区块链技术的迅猛发展,越来越多的人开始涉足数字货币的世界。在这个过程中,钱包作为存储和管理数字资产的工具,变得尤为重要。但对于许多人来说,区块链钱包的工作原理仍然是一个比较模糊的概念。本文将详细解读区块链钱包的原理,并通过图解的方式帮助读者更好地理解其内部机制和工作流程。

                区块链钱包的基本概念

                在讨论区块链钱包的原理之前,首先需要明确什么是区块链钱包。一种区块链钱包是指一个用于存储、接收和发送数字货币的工具,功能类似于一个银行账户。尽管它并不是真正的“钱包”,因为它并不直接存储货币,而是存储密钥(公钥和私钥),以便在区块链网络上执行交易。

                区块链本身是一个去中心化的分布式账本,它记录了所有的交易历史。这些交易通过加密措施确保安全性,只有拥有私钥的用户才能对与之关联的数字资产进行控制。因此,钱包的安全性直接关系到用户资产的安全。

                区块链钱包的类型

                区块链钱包主要分为两大类:热钱包和冷钱包。热钱包是指连接到互联网的数字钱包,方便快速交易,但同时也面临着网络攻击的风险。常见的热钱包包括手机应用(如Coinbase、Blockchain.info等)和在线钱包。相对而言,冷钱包是指不连接到互联网的数字钱包,如硬件钱包(Ledger、Trezor等)和纸钱包,这种方式相对安全,但使用上更为麻烦。

                了解这两种钱包的特点有助于用户根据自己的需求选择合适的钱包。一般来说,如果你频繁进行交易,可以选择热钱包;如果你希望长期持有数字资产,则冷钱包可能更为合适。

                区块链钱包的核心原理

                1. 私钥与公钥:

                区块链钱包的运作依赖于公钥密码学。每个钱包都有一对密钥:公钥和私钥。公钥可以理解为一个银行账户的账号,任何人都可以通过公钥向你支付数字货币。而私钥则是银行账号的密码,只有你拥有才能控制和管理钱包内的资产。私钥是任何时候都不能泄露给他人的信息,失去私钥,就无法找回你的资产。

                2. 交易签名:

                在区块链网络上进行交易时,用户需要使用私钥对交易进行签名。这个过程相当于用密码确认一笔交易的合法性。只有持有私钥的人才能对该笔交易进行签名。一旦签名完成,交易会被广播到网络上进行验证和确认。

                3. 区块链网络验证:

                在交易被发出后,矿工会通过验证其有效性,将其打包到一个新区块中。这个过程会涉及到复杂的计算,通常需要一定的时间,直至交易被确认。区块链的去中心化特性使得每一个交易都可以由网络中的多个节点进行验证,从而杜绝了伪造交易的可能性。

                区块链钱包的工作流程

                了解了区块链钱包的基本原理后,我们接下来看看它的工作流程:

                1. 创建钱包:

                用户首先需要创建一个钱包。在这个过程中,系统会自动生成一对公钥和私钥。同时,私钥应该被安全地备份下来,以防丢失。对于大部分钱包应用,用户在创建过程中会提醒你备份私钥或助记词。

                2. 接收资金:

                用户可以将公钥分享给其他用户,方便他们向自己的钱包发送资金。接收资金的操作非常简单,只需将他人的转账请求信息输入钱包即可。相应地,系统会更新你的钱包余额,整个过程在区块链上实时记录。

                3. 发送资金:

                如果用户需要向其他钱包发送资金,就需要输入接收方的公钥(或钱包地址)和转账的金额。系统会使用用户的私钥对这笔交易进行签名,并将其广播到区块链网络中。矿工会对这笔交易进行验证,在确认之后将其添加到区块链中,同时更新双方的钱包余额。

                区块链钱包的安全性分析

                钱存在于钱包中,但它们并非以某种物理形态存在,而是通过私钥和公钥的形式进行管理。因此,钱包的安全性在很大程度上取决于用户对私钥的保护能力。无论是热钱包还是冷钱包,都有各自的安全性考虑。在此,我们就各类钱包的安全风险进行深入分析。

                1. 热钱包的安全性:

                热钱包由于直接连接互联网,相对容易受到黑客攻击。例如,许多人使用在线交易所提供的钱包进行存储,但一旦交易所遭受黑客攻击,用户的资产便会处于风险之中。因此,对于热钱包进行多重身份验证、定期更改密码、使用防火墙等安全措施是非常必要的。

                2. 冷钱包的安全性:

                冷钱包虽然不直接连接互联网,但也并非完全无懈可击。例如,硬件钱包可能因为物理损坏而无法恢复,纸钱包则有被火灾、污染或遗失等风险。因此,要定期备份私钥和助记词,并将其存储在安全的地方。

                关于区块链钱包的常见问题

                在深入了解区块链钱包之后,许多人会对其产生一些疑问。在本文的最后,我们将解答五个相关的常见问题。

                如何选择一个合适的区块链钱包?

                选择合适的区块链钱包取决于用户的具体需求和使用场景。以下是一些建议:

                1. 安全性:用户应优先考虑钱包的安全性,尤其是在长时间持有资产的情况下。冷钱包通常被认为是最安全的选择,适合长期持有;而热钱包则适合频繁交易,但需要采取多重身份验证等措施保障安全。

                2. 用户体验:不同钱包的界面和功能各不相同,用户在选择时应考虑使用的方便程度。为了确保流畅的操作体验,选择一个界面友好的钱包是非常重要的。

                3. 支持的数字资产:不同的钱包支持的数字资产种类可能有所不同。确保你所选择的钱包能满足你的所有需求,支持你常用的数字货币。

                4. 社区口碑:可以通过阅读用户评价或参考专家意见来评估一个钱包的可靠性和安全性。

                5. 客服支持:选择一个有良好客户服务支持的钱包,将确保在遇到问题时能够及时获得帮助。

                区块链钱包的私钥丢失了怎么办?

                失去私钥意味着失去对钱包中资产的控制。因而,用户在创建钱包时务必要做好私钥的备份。如果私钥一旦丢失,用户将无法找回钱包中的数字资产。这里有几点建议:

                1. 备份计划:在创建钱包时,务必记录下私钥或助记词,并将其存储在安全的地方。如果有条件,建议使用物理硬件(如USB闪存)进行备份,确保备份不在同一地点。

                2. 恢复助记词:有些钱包提供助记词(一个由12个或更多单词组成的短语),用户可以使用这些助记词恢复钱包。如果用户丢失了私钥,但仍然保留助记词,那么一般情况下可以通过助记词恢复钱包访问。

                3. 严格保密:任何时候都不要将私钥或助记词分享给其他人,不要在社交网络上公开这些信息,以防信息被黑客获取。

                区块链钱包的转账速度有多快?

                区块链钱包的转账速度取决于多个因素,包括所在区块链的网络负载、交易费用和矿工的确认速度。以下是一些详细的讨论:

                1. 网络拥堵:在高需求期间,网络拥堵会导致交易确认时间变长。像比特币这样的网络在处理大量交易时可能会变慢,而以太坊和其他新兴区块链对此有更好的解决方案。用户在高峰期发送交易时要考虑这一点。

                2. 交易费用:许多区块链网络允许用户设置交易费用。较高的费用通常可以吸引更多矿工快速处理交易。因此,如果用户希望快速完成转账,可以适当提高交易费用。

                3. 确认过程:在许多区块链网络中,交易需要经过若干确认才被认为是最终的。通过查看区块链区块浏览器,用户可以关注其交易的确认状态。这也会影响到用户的资金能否及时到账。

                如何确保区块链钱包的安全性?

                保证区块链钱包安全性的方式有很多,用户应该采取综合的安全措施来有效保护自己的资产:

                1. 使用强密码:选择一个复杂度高的密码,不要与其他账户共享同一密码,并定期更换密码,以降低被攻击的风险。

                2. 启用双重身份验证(2FA):许多钱包和交易所都支持双重身份验证,增加了额外的安全层,提升账户安全性。

                3. 防避免钓鱼攻击:不要轻易点击不明链接,更不要在不熟悉的网站输入自己的私钥或助记词。此外,确保桌面或移动设备上没有恶意软件存在。

                4. 确保设备安全:定期更新操作系统、应用程序和杀毒软件,确保计算设备的安全。

                5. 谨慎使用公共Wi-Fi:避免在公共场合使用免费的Wi-Fi进行敏感操作,使用VPN进行安全加密。

                如何避免被欺诈和骗局?

                随着区块链技术和数字货币的不断发展,骗局层出不穷,避免成为受害者的关键在于保持警惕。以下是一些防范措施:

                1. 理性投资:对待数字货币投资,保持理智,不要被短期内的暴利诱惑所迷惑。避免向承诺高回报的项目投资,这往往是骗局的潜在信号。

                2. 验证信息来源:在参与任何投资或交易之前,确保对相关信息进行了充分的调查。查看项目的官方网站,确保其真实可信。

                3. 不轻信陌生人:无论是社交媒体还是其他平台上的消息,都要保持怀疑态度,特别是涉及到资金的请求。切忌随意泄露个人信息、私钥或钱包地址。

                4. 使用确保安全的平台:选择知名且信誉良好的交易所和钱包,避免使用不明或评价不佳的平台。

                通过对区块链钱包工作原理的深入了解,以及对相关问题的详细解析,相信读者对区块链钱包的概念、类型和使用都有了较为全面的认识。这一知识将有助于用户在数字资产管理过程中做出更明智的决策,从而更好地保护自己的资产。